小编Pet*_*ete的帖子

VBA正确输入下一个空行的用户表单数据

  1. 创建了一个用户表单
  2. 添加了一个textBox和一个comboBox
  3. 添加了提交按钮
  4. 单击提交后,它会将数据添加到电子表格中

从我被告知的内容和我所读到的内容来看,这是错误的

ActiveCell.Value = TextBox3.Text 
ActiveCell.Offset(0, 1).Select   
ActiveCell.Value = ComboBox1.Text  
ActiveCell.Offset(1, -1).Select  
Run Code Online (Sandbox Code Playgroud)

这有效,但我被告知我不应该尽可能使用.select关键字.我已经读过,为了使我的代码可以重用,我应该创建变量.专业开发人员如何编写此代码,可以用更少的行编写,如何在不使用select的情况下引用activecell偏移?

excel vba excel-vba

3
推荐指数
1
解决办法
6万
查看次数

标签 统计

excel ×1

excel-vba ×1

vba ×1